Subject: Quickstore 4.2 — bloom filter now fronts the KV layer

Plugin authors: starting with this release, Quickstore places a bloom filter ahead of the key-value store. Negative lookups return faster; false positives fall through safely. No API changes are required on your side. Verify your plugin against the staging build referenced below.

session token of fahif-tadup = htk3_9c7

## Support

If you observe GC pauses above 200 ms in the Pairwise matching service, collect a heap histogram and the pause log from the Lattice dashboard before filing anything. Most pauses trace back to the candidate-cache growth issue documented in the tuning guide. Contractors should send findings and questions to the team at the address below.

pager mailbox: druwyn@norvaio.corp

Each release tarball includes the rotation schedules, provider adapters, and a detached signature. On-call engineers deploying a hotfix must verify the signature before promotion — a tampered Rotarium build can silently rewrite rotation targets, which is the worst failure mode we have. Do not skip verification even under incident pressure; the fallback runbook covers signature failures. Verification should be performed against the release key shown below.

release key, hahig-tahop: bky9_M2QMJ6LkR